> The 'dist-configs' is not working properly as it only creates ELN
> configs. The
> 'rh-configs' and 'fedora-configs' targets are not working properly and
> should
> be creating ELN and Fedora configs but they only create some
> temporary/intermediate build files. These targets should output final
> .config
> files for each supported arch. The code has been modified to output
> final
> .config files.
> 
> While fixing this I noticed a few other things that needed to be fixed.
> 
>     - The TARGET and DIST_TARGET variables in redhat/Makefile are
> unused.
>     - 'make fedora-configs' fails due to a config mismatch on
> CONFIG_FORCE_MAX_ZONEORDER
>     - The configs/process_configs.sh script left *.orig files lying
> around
> 
> The code has been modified to fix these as well.
